COFFS HARBOUR GATEWAY FOR HUGHES FUNERAL

Coffs Harbour became the gateway for thousands of people, arriving for Phil Hughes’ funeral.

Sombre cricketers, along with other sporting identities and dignitaries filed into the arrivals lounge this morning.

Premier Mike Baird was one of those who landed on a scheduled domestic flight.

At one stage, almost a dozen planes of all shapes and sizes were lined up on the tarmac.

“Three charter flights, 737 charters and a couple of smaller ones and obviously the regular services as well,” said Airport Manager Dennis Martin.

Prime Minister Tony Abbott and Federal Opposition Leader Bill Shorten arrived aboard a RAAF jet, amid tight security.

They left for Macksville in a convoy of cars with a police escort.
